
在WPS表格中自动匹配数据库的基本方法包括:使用函数VLOOKUP、利用MATCH和INDEX函数、使用数据透视表、结合外部数据库查询。这里我们详细介绍使用VLOOKUP函数来实现这一功能。
使用VLOOKUP函数是最常见的方法之一。VLOOKUP函数可以在指定的范围内查找并返回与指定值相关联的数据。例如,你可以利用VLOOKUP函数在一个表格中查找对应数据库中的数据,并将其自动匹配到WPS表格中。下面我们将逐步探讨更多的自动匹配数据库的方法和技巧。
一、使用VLOOKUP函数
VLOOKUP函数是Excel和WPS表格中最常用的查找函数之一。它可以在表格的第一列中查找指定值,并返回同一行中指定列的值。其基本语法为:
VLOOKUP(lookup_value, table_array, col_index_num, [range_lookup])
lookup_value:要查找的值。table_array:包含数据的表格范围。col_index_num:要返回的列的列号。range_lookup:可选参数,确定查找方式(精确匹配或近似匹配)。
1. 设置数据源
首先,确保你的数据源已经整理好,并且存放在一个可以访问的地方。通常情况下,数据源可以是另一个WPS表格文件、数据库或是本地存储的CSV文件。
2. 创建查找表
在WPS表格中创建一个查找表,这个表格包含你要匹配的数据。例如,你可能有一个表格包含了员工ID和对应的姓名,而你需要在另一个表格中根据员工ID查找并填充姓名。
3. 应用VLOOKUP函数
在目标表格中,选择要填充数据的单元格,并输入VLOOKUP函数。例如,在B2单元格中输入以下公式以查找并填充员工姓名:
=VLOOKUP(A2, '查找表格'!A:B, 2, FALSE)
这里,A2是要查找的员工ID,'查找表格'!A:B是查找表格的范围,2表示返回第二列的数据,FALSE表示精确匹配。
二、使用MATCH和INDEX函数
MATCH和INDEX函数组合使用也可以实现类似于VLOOKUP的功能,并且在某些情况下更灵活。MATCH函数返回指定值在一个范围中的位置,而INDEX函数根据指定的行和列号返回单元格的值。
1. 使用MATCH函数
MATCH函数可以用来找到一个值在范围中的位置,其基本语法为:
MATCH(lookup_value, lookup_array, [match_type])
例如:
=MATCH(A2, '查找表格'!A:A, 0)
2. 使用INDEX函数
INDEX函数根据给定的行号和列号返回单元格的值,其基本语法为:
INDEX(array, row_num, [column_num])
例如:
=INDEX('查找表格'!B:B, MATCH(A2, '查找表格'!A:A, 0))
三、使用数据透视表
数据透视表是另一种强大的数据分析工具,可以用于汇总和匹配数据。通过创建数据透视表,可以快速匹配和分析大规模数据。
1. 创建数据透视表
在WPS表格中,选择数据区域,然后点击“插入”选项卡,选择“数据透视表”。在弹出的对话框中选择数据源和放置数据透视表的位置。
2. 配置数据透视表
在数据透视表字段列表中,拖动字段到行、列和数值区域。通过配置数据透视表,你可以快速实现数据匹配和汇总。
四、结合外部数据库查询
通过WPS表格的“数据”选项卡,可以连接到外部数据库(如MySQL、SQL Server等)并导入数据,实现数据的自动匹配和更新。
1. 连接到数据库
在WPS表格中,点击“数据”选项卡,选择“从数据库导入”选项。在弹出的对话框中,输入数据库连接信息(如服务器地址、数据库名称、用户名和密码)。
2. 查询数据库
连接到数据库后,可以使用SQL查询语句来获取所需的数据。将查询结果导入WPS表格中,并利用上述方法(如VLOOKUP、MATCH和INDEX)实现数据匹配。
五、使用宏和脚本
如果你的数据匹配需求比较复杂,或者需要自动化处理,可以考虑使用宏和脚本。WPS表格支持VBA宏和Python脚本,可以编写自定义的代码来实现自动匹配数据库的功能。
1. 创建宏
在WPS表格中,点击“开发工具”选项卡,选择“录制宏”。录制完宏后,可以在VBA编辑器中编辑宏代码。
2. 编写脚本
WPS表格也支持Python脚本。在“开发工具”选项卡下,选择“Python脚本”选项,可以编写并运行Python代码来处理数据匹配。
六、推荐使用项目管理系统
在项目团队管理过程中,使用专业的项目管理系统可以大大提高效率。研发项目管理系统PingCode和通用项目协作软件Worktile是两个值得推荐的系统。
1. PingCode
PingCode是一款专为研发项目设计的管理系统,提供了丰富的功能,包括任务管理、代码管理、需求跟踪、缺陷管理等。通过PingCode,可以轻松实现团队协作和项目进度管理,提高研发效率。
2. Worktile
Worktile是一款通用的项目协作软件,适用于各种类型的项目管理。Worktile提供了任务管理、文档协作、日历安排等功能,支持团队成员之间的高效协作和信息共享。
七、总结
在WPS表格中自动匹配数据库的方法多种多样,选择适合的方法可以大大提高工作效率。常用的方法包括使用VLOOKUP函数、MATCH和INDEX函数组合、数据透视表、外部数据库查询以及宏和脚本。此外,使用专业的项目管理系统(如PingCode和Worktile)可以进一步提升团队协作效率。无论是哪种方法,关键是根据具体需求选择合适的工具和技术。
相关问答FAQs:
1. 在WPS表格中如何实现与数据库的自动匹配?
在WPS表格中,你可以通过以下步骤实现与数据库的自动匹配:
- 步骤1: 首先,确保你已经连接到了相应的数据库。在WPS表格中,点击"数据"选项卡,然后选择"从外部数据源",接着选择"从数据库获取数据"。
- 步骤2: 在弹出的对话框中,选择你要连接的数据库类型,并填写相应的连接信息,如数据库服务器地址、用户名和密码等。
- 步骤3: 连接成功后,选择你要从数据库中获取数据的表格或查询,点击"导入"按钮。WPS表格会自动将数据库中的数据导入到当前工作表中。
- 步骤4: 在需要进行匹配的单元格中,使用VLOOKUP函数或其他相关函数来进行匹配。根据你的需求,可以选择不同的匹配方式,如精确匹配、模糊匹配等。
2. 如何使用WPS表格实现自动匹配数据库中的数据?
要使用WPS表格实现自动匹配数据库中的数据,你可以按照以下步骤进行操作:
- 步骤1: 首先,确保你已经连接到了目标数据库。在WPS表格中,点击"数据"选项卡,然后选择"从外部数据源",接着选择"从数据库获取数据"。
- 步骤2: 在弹出的对话框中,填写正确的数据库连接信息,如服务器地址、用户名和密码等。点击"连接"按钮,确保连接成功。
- 步骤3: 在数据导入向导中,选择你要导入的数据表格或查询,点击"导入"按钮。WPS表格会自动将数据库中的数据导入到当前工作表中。
- 步骤4: 在需要进行匹配的单元格中,使用相关函数来实现自动匹配。例如,使用VLOOKUP函数可以在数据库中查找特定的值,并返回匹配的结果。
3. WPS表格中如何使用自动匹配功能与数据库进行数据对比?
在WPS表格中,你可以使用自动匹配功能与数据库进行数据对比。以下是一些操作步骤:
- 步骤1: 首先,确保你已经成功连接到了目标数据库。在WPS表格中,点击"数据"选项卡,然后选择"从外部数据源",接着选择"从数据库获取数据"。
- 步骤2: 在弹出的对话框中,填写正确的数据库连接信息,如服务器地址、用户名和密码等。点击"连接"按钮,确保连接成功。
- 步骤3: 在数据导入向导中,选择你要导入的数据表格或查询,点击"导入"按钮。WPS表格会自动将数据库中的数据导入到当前工作表中。
- 步骤4: 在需要进行数据对比的单元格中,使用相关函数来实现自动匹配和比较。例如,使用IF函数可以根据数据库中的数据与表格中的数据进行对比,并返回相应的结果。
请注意,以上步骤仅为参考,实际操作可能会因具体情况而有所不同。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/1975374